ISSUES OF IMPROVING THE CURRICULUM OF CHOIR CONDUCTING IN HIGHER PEDAGOGICAL EDUCATION IN UZBEKISTAN

This article analyzes the issues of improving the curriculum of choral conducting in the higher pedagogical education system of Uzbekistan. The need to develop innovative approaches, pedagogical technologies and software materials based on national traditions to improve educational processes in this area is justified. The author highlights the possibilities of combining theoretical and practical aspects of choral conducting, forming creative and professional competencies in students, as well as adapting international experience to local conditions. The article also discusses the position of choral conducting in curricula, current problems in the practice process and proposals for their solution.
